I've been doing a lot of browsing on my N800. It's screen is 800 pixels wide - and if the browser isn't in full-screen mode, it's more like 700 pixels wide. If the whole page won't fit in those 800 pixels, the overhang hangs off the right-hand side of the screen.

If something is going to fall off the side of the screen, I want it to be the ads and the navbar, not the content. Even if the browser manages to make both sidebars + the content fit on the screen, it the sidebars can take up a good 350-400 pixels by themselves. Dropping the left sidebar gives another 100-150 pixels to the content.
